How to fill out patient access policy

Illustration

How to fill out patient access policy

01
Begin with the patient access policy template provided by your organization.
02
Clearly define the purpose of the policy, outlining its significance for patient access.
03
Identify the scope of the policy, specifying which departments or practices it applies to.
04
Detail the process for patients to access their medical records, including any necessary forms.
05
Include guidelines for how patients can request appointments and communicate with healthcare providers.
06
Outline the rights of the patients regarding their data and access to health information.
07
Specify the responsibilities of staff in assisting patients with access requests.
08
Provide contact information for the office or individual responsible for managing patient access queries.
09
Review the policy for clarity and ensure compliance with relevant laws and regulations.
10
Obtain necessary approvals from management and communicate the policy to all relevant stakeholders.
